I went to the American Racing website and they have that SoftWheels program where you can view different wheels on your vehicle. When I click on the link I get nothing but a blank screen with a small box that has 3 different colored shapes in it.
I tried 2 other sites that have the same program and got the same results. I downloaded the latest version of Java, and made sure it was enabled.
Any idea what the problem is?
